Study Summary
This study is to determine the effects of anorexia nervosa on bone mass and hormone levels in adolescents. Whether administration of estrogen, a normal hormone present during puberty, can help maintain bone development in girls with anorexia nervosa will be determined.
Interventions
- OTHER Placebo
- DRUG Physiologic Estrogen/progesterone
